  document number: 29118 for tec hnical questions, contact: nlr@vishay.com www.vishay.com revision: 20-may-11 1 this document is subject to change without notice. the products described herein and this document are subject to specific disclaimers, set forth at www.vishay.com/doc?91000 ntc thermistors, 2-point radial leaded, automotive grade ntcle203e3...sb0 vishay bccomponents features ? high accuracy over a wide temperature range ? high stability over a long life ? exceptional thermal shock withstanding performance ? aec-q200 qualified ? compliant to rohs directive 2002/95/ec and in accordance to weee 2002/96/ec ? fulfils the elv 2000/53/ec applications ? temperature measurement, sensing and control, temperature compens ation in automoti ve and industrial applications ? applications as egr, ect, iat, and tmap sensors description these thermistors consist of a ntc ceramic chip with two solid tin plated nickel leads. the thermistor body is coated with a blue insulating lacquer. packaging the thermistors are packed in bu lk (qty = 500 pcs). tape and reel available on request. design-in support r (t) table spreadsheet available on request at nlr@vishay.com . accuracy over the whole temperature range, see at the resistance vs. temperature tables. mounting by soldering or welding in any position. the thermistors are fully suitable to be potted in epoxy or silicon resins. note (1) ? t is the temperature measurement accuracy in the defined temperature range quick reference data parameter value unit resistance value at 25 c 2.06k to 30k ? tolerance on r 25 -value 1.93 to 2.20 % b 25/85 -value 3528 to 4090 k tolerance on b 25/85 -value 0.5 to 0.75 % operating temperature range - 55 to 150 c temperature accuracy between 25 c and 85 c measurement 0.5 c maximum dissipation 100 mw response time (in stirred air) 7 s climatic category (lct/uct/days) 55/150/56 minimum dielectric withstanding voltage (tested according to iec 60539 4.7.2 method 1) 500 v rms weight 0.1 g electrical data and ordering information sap material and ordering number old 12nc code r at 25 c ( ? ) ? at 25 c (%/k) r 25 tol.
